Dieter roth april 21, 1930 june 5, 1998 was a swiss artist best known for his artists books, editioned prints, sculptures, and works made of found materials, including rotting food stuffs. In 1982 roth represented switzerland at the venice biennale, and received a number of awards throughout his life including the prestigious swiss prize, caran dache beaux arts in 1991. After attending both primary and higher secondary school in germany, roth was sent to stay with a family in zurich in 1943, where he was joined three years later by his parents.
